Had another question on something I can't seem to find on the search. The clear tube that comes down on the rear drivers side of the engine. It's about an inch in diameter. What is it and why is there a haze of smoke coming out of it?

Mine is clear too :shrug: The compression that blows past the rings goes into the crankcase and has to be vented somewhere so it goes out that tube. That is why it is used to measure engine wear. There is a certain test you do with a manometer (water column) and if it has too much pressure then the engine needs a rebuild.
